When connecting a port replicator or connecting the notebook to a docking
station, open the expansion port cover (instead of the entire port cover) and
then make the connection. Refer to section 3.7 for details.
The onboard serial infrared (SIR) port is IrDA-compliant and allows you to
perform wireless file transfers and "connect" with other serial infrared
devices such as a serial infrared printer.
To transfer files using SIR, line up the SIR ports of the notebook and the
other SIR-capable system not more than a meter apart, at an angle of ±15
degrees for optimal performance.
